As promised in the end of "At World's End," Jack's looking for the Fountain of Youth if for nothing more than ships and giggles. The "new" course set by "On Stranger Tides" uses worn sails, but with a fresh wind of characters and more importantly, a more direct purpose. ![]() After exhausting the "Pirates" world with two back-to-back sequels of titanic and rather disappointing proportion in 20, a break in the action to recalibrate Captain Jack Sparrow's compass was much-needed. After a four-year hiatus to regroup and determine the future of the franchise, Disney and what was once its surprise mega-hit "Pirates of the Caribbean" series have returned in "On Stranger Tides." Hard to believe that this franchise evolved from the once-lambasted concept of a theme park ride being turned into a successful motion-picture blockbuster.
